The China Specialty Diagnostic Enzyme Market has been experiencing notable growth in recent years, driven by increasing demand for specialized diagnostic tools in various healthcare and research applications. Specialty diagnostic enzymes are crucial components in biochemical assays and diagnostic kits, facilitating the detection and monitoring of diseases and medical conditions. These enzymes are essential in applications ranging from diagnostics of metabolic disorders to cancer detection and infectious disease identification. Their role in accurate and early diagnosis has positioned them as indispensable tools in the Chinese healthcare sector. The market is also growing due to advancements in biotechnology, expanding research sectors, and the ongoing efforts by pharmaceutical companies to develop targeted treatments. Additionally, government support for healthcare infrastructure improvement and increasing awareness about the importance of early disease detection has spurred the market's expansion.

In terms of application, the China Specialty Diagnostic Enzyme Market is segmented into three major categories: Pharmaceuticals, Research & Biotechnology, and Others. Each of these subsegments plays a crucial role in driving the demand for specialty diagnostic enzymes, with varying requirements and applications across industries. The pharmaceuticals sector is one of the leading contributors to the market. Specialty diagnostic enzymes are widely used in the development and production of diagnostic kits and medical devices for disease detection. Pharmaceutical companies utilize these enzymes for assays that are integral to drug development and clinical trials, especially in molecular diagnostics. As personalized medicine and tailored therapeutic strategies gain traction in the pharmaceutical industry, the demand for these enzymes is likely to continue its upward trajectory. Moreover, the growing number of chronic diseases and age-related health issues in China has resulted in a heightened need for diagnostic tools that can identify diseases at an early stage, which drives the growth of diagnostic enzyme demand in the pharmaceutical sector.
The Research & Biotechnology subsegment is another key area within the China Specialty Diagnostic Enzyme Market. Enzymes are integral to a variety of research applications, including genetic studies, protein analysis, and other molecular biology tasks. Biotechnology firms leverage these enzymes for scientific innovations, including the development of better diagnostic methods and the production of therapeutic biologics. Furthermore, the biopharmaceutical industry heavily relies on enzymes for various research purposes, such as in the analysis of biomarkers and gene mutations that aid in the understanding and treatment of complex diseases like cancer and genetic disorders. As China continues to invest in biotechnology and research infrastructure, the demand for specialty diagnostic enzymes in this field is expected to see substantial growth, particularly in fields like precision medicine and the creation of novel biotech solutions.
The 'Others' category in the market refers to miscellaneous applications that are outside the pharmaceutical and research domains. These applications include, but are not limited to, food testing, environmental monitoring, and diagnostic applications in veterinary medicine. In the food and beverage industry, diagnostic enzymes are employed to detect pathogens and monitor quality control. Similarly, in environmental monitoring, enzymes are used to identify contaminants in water and soil, ensuring regulatory compliance and public health. In veterinary diagnostics, enzymes play a crucial role in identifying diseases in animals, which is particularly important in managing livestock health and preventing the spread of zoonotic diseases. While this subsegment is comparatively smaller than the pharmaceuticals and biotechnology segments, its contribution is significant and growing as more industries recognize the value of diagnostic enzymes for their operations.
Key Trends in the China Specialty Diagnostic Enzyme Market include the rapid adoption of molecular diagnostic technologies, driven by advancements in genetic testing and personalized medicine. The demand for rapid and accurate diagnostic tools, especially in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, has further accelerated the market growth. Additionally, automation in diagnostic processes is increasingly being adopted, improving efficiency and reducing human error. There is also a notable trend toward the development of cost-effective enzyme-based diagnostic kits, which is making these tools more accessible to a broader range of healthcare facilities, particularly in rural areas of China. Furthermore, advancements in enzyme engineering and biotechnology are allowing for the production of more specific and sensitive diagnostic enzymes, contributing to more accurate and reliable diagnostic results.
